Stability and Growth of Payments

Fetching dividends data

Stable Dividend: UHR's dividend payments have been volatile in the past 10 years.

Growing Dividend: UHR's dividend payments have fallen over the past 10 years.

Notable Dividend: UHR's dividend (2.29%) is higher than the bottom 25% of dividend payers in the Swiss market (1.94%).

High Dividend: UHR's dividend (2.29%) is low compared to the top 25% of dividend payers in the Swiss market (3.64%).


Earnings Payout to Shareholders

Earnings Coverage: With its high payout ratio (7785.7%), UHR's dividend payments are not well covered by earnings.


Cash Payout to Shareholders

Cash Flow Coverage: With its high cash payout ratio (403.4%), UHR's dividend payments are not well covered by cash flows.
